Given our rural roads and seasonal temperature swings, we frequently address suspension components worn by rough terrain and electrical issues related to aging wiring. Volkswagen-specific problems like ignition coil failures in certain models and diesel particulate filter concerns in TDI vehicles are also common repairs we handle locally.

Before winter, have your battery and charging system tested, as cold snaps are hard on older batteries. Also, ensure your DSG automatic transmission service is up-to-date, as proper fluid condition is critical for performance in both summer heat and the stop-and-go driving common on our county roads.
